NUISANCE TRIPPING OF INPUT CIRCUIT BREAKER
Some reports from field installations indicate that the 15 or 20 amp, single pole circuit breaker feeding main power to
the Mac Victor
®
Power Network (MVPN) will sometimes trip off upon startup of the POWERVAR UPM. In all cases,
factory testing has indicated that this problem is not associated with defects in the POWERVAR UPM. POWERVAR’s
investigation has revealed that when the MVPN is located in close proximity to the panelboard (approximately 10
feet), the current inrush caused by the initial start up of the UPM can trip the panelboard branch circuit breaker due to
high magnetic inrush even when it is not overloaded. The solution to this problem is to replace the circuit breaker with
one that can withstand the high magnetic inrush of the UPM startup.

Listed below are the approved circuit breakers for various panelboard manufacturers that are designed to withstand
this high magnetic inrush.
Panelboard
Manufacturer: Part Numbers:
Square D QO-115-HM or QO-120-HM (snap on)
QOB-115-HM or QOB-120-HM (bolt on)
GE THQL1115HID or THQL1120HID (snap on)
THQB1115HID or THQB1120HID (bolt on)
Cutler Hammer HQP1015D or HQP1020D (snap on)
BAB1015D or BAB1020D (bolt on)
